- Stora Enso’s second-quarter sales reached EU2.43 billion, closely matching market estimates of EU2.44 billion.
- The company’s adjusted earnings per share (EPS) were EU0.050, which fell short of the estimated EU0.08.
- Adjusted EBIT was reported at EU126 million, exceeding the market expectation of EU123 million.
- The adjusted EBITDA margin was recorded at 11.5%.
- Analyst recommendations include 13 buys, 3 holds, and 3 sells.

Investment analyst Jesus Rodriguez Aguilar on Smartkarma has published a bullish research report titled “Stora Enso: Hidden Forest Value Unlock With a Clean Break Catalyst“. In the report, Aguilar highlights that Stora Enso’s forest spin-off is expected to unlock hidden NAV and improve valuation transparency. This strategic move, while not reducing debt as shares are directly distributed to shareholders, is anticipated to sharpen the group’s profile and create a potential re-rating opportunity. The report also emphasizes that Stora Enso’s industrial operations are undervalued compared to peers, signifying the potential for upside in the event of a cyclical recovery. Moreover, the Sum-Of-The-Parts (SOTP) path simplification is seen as a step to address conglomerate discount and enhance investor transparency.
